From ead9ae5a69a55a6416469d23cf02c49c223a8d7f Mon Sep 17 00:00:00 2001 From: Peter Johnson Date: Fri, 17 Nov 2023 10:39:28 -0600 Subject: [PATCH] [build] Add generateProto dependency to test and dev (#5933) --- shared/jni/setupBuild.gradle |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/shared/jni/setupBuild.gradle b/shared/jni/setupBuild.gradle index d877932922..de7c50f49b 100644 --- a/shared/jni/setupBuild.gradle +++ b/shared/jni/setupBuild.gradle @@ -223,6 +223,9 @@ model { nativeUtils.useRequiredLibrary(it, 'ni_link_libraries', 'ni_runtime_libraries') } } + it.tasks.withType(CppCompile) { + it.dependsOn generateProto + } if (project.hasProperty('exeSplitSetup')) { exeSplitSetup(it) } @@ -276,6 +279,9 @@ model { nativeUtils.useRequiredLibrary(it, 'ni_link_libraries', 'ni_runtime_libraries') } } + it.tasks.withType(CppCompile) { + it.dependsOn generateProto + } if (project.hasProperty('exeSplitSetup')) { exeSplitSetup(it) }